FULBRIGHT SPECIALIST NEEDS ASSESSMENT PROGRAMME HELD

The Fulbright Specialist Needs Assessment and Gender Equity programme, which commenced on Friday, January 24, 2025, at the Ho Technical University (HTU), has been concluded.

Led by Fulbright Specialist, Mr. Philip Agbeko, the week-long programme engaged various categories of staff across departments, including Management, Senior Members, Heads of Departments, and Faculty.

Through interactive engagements, participants shared insights into their strengths, challenges, and areas requiring development, highlighting gaps in resource allocation, operational efficiency, infrastructure, and capacity-building.

Mr. Agbeko commended participants for their openness and collaborative spirit, noting that the insights gathered would inform actionable strategies to address the university’s identified needs.

The programme aimed to align HTU’s needs with its strategic plan, leveraging existing strengths while mobilising resources to bridge critical gaps.

The outcomes of the programme are expected to contribute to the development of capacity-building strategies and a roadmap for sustainable institutional growth.
